AI GPTs for Equipment Insights refer to advanced artificial intelligence tools based on the Generative Pre-trained Transformer technology, tailored specifically for analyzing, predicting, and optimizing the performance of various equipment. These tools leverage large volumes of data to provide actionable insights, facilitating maintenance, improving reliability, and enhancing operational efficiency in equipment-intensive industries.

Key Attributes and Capabilities

These GPTs tools stand out for their adaptability across a wide range of equipment-related tasks, from predictive maintenance to energy consumption optimization. Key features include natural language processing for interpreting complex queries, machine learning for predictive analytics, integration capabilities with IoT devices for real-time monitoring, and advanced data analysis for identifying trends and anomalies in equipment performance.

Frequently Asked Questions

What are AI GPTs for Equipment Insights?

AI GPTs for Equipment Insights are specialized AI tools designed to analyze and optimize equipment performance using data-driven insights.

How do these tools improve equipment maintenance?

By leveraging predictive analytics to forecast potential failures and schedule proactive maintenance, thereby reducing downtime.
